Why Choose Colombia for Dental Tourism (Dental Tourism in Colombia)
Quality Dental Care
Colombian dental clinics are known for their high-quality dental care. Many dentists are trained in the United States or Europe and bring their expertise back to Colombia. Additionally, clinics often have advanced dental technologies comparable to those in the US and Europe.
Affordability
Colombia offers dental care at a fraction of the cost of the same procedures in the US, Canada, and Europe. Savings can range from 50% to 70%, making it possible for many people to afford procedures that may be out of reach in their home countries.
Convenient Travel
Colombia’s geographical proximity to North America makes it a convenient destination for travelers from the US and Canada. Major airlines operate regular flights to Colombian cities, ensuring easy accessibility.
Common Dental Procedures in Colombia
Here are some of the most common dental procedures sought by tourists in Colombia:
- Dental Implants: Dental implants replace missing or damaged teeth with artificial ones that function like real ones.
- Crowns and Bridges: These replace or cover damaged teeth, improving the appearance and functionality of the mouth.
- Veneers: Veneers are thin pieces of porcelain used to recreate the natural look of teeth.
- Teeth Whitening: A popular cosmetic procedure, teeth whitening can greatly improve the appearance of your smile.
- Root Canals: This procedure treats issues in the tooth’s center, often alleviating pain and saving the tooth.
Planning Your Dental Tourism Trip to Colombia
Research and Select a Dental Clinic
Choose a reputable clinic that specializes in the procedure you need. Check the clinic’s credentials, read patient reviews, and look for accreditation from international dental associations.
Schedule an Appointment
Contact the dental clinic to schedule an appointment. Be prepared to send your dental records and any relevant information. Some clinics may also provide a virtual consultation before your visit.
Plan Your Trip
Look into flight and accommodation options. Some dental clinics may offer assistance with travel and lodging arrangements. Be sure to budget time for recovery and sightseeing, depending on your procedure.
Prepare for Your Procedure
Follow any pre-appointment instructions from your dentist. Remember to pack any necessary medications and items that will contribute to a comfortable recovery.
Top Cities for Dental Tourism in Colombia
- Bogota: The capital city boasts numerous high-quality dental clinics and is easily accessible via direct international flights.
- Medellin: Known for its beautiful weather and modern healthcare facilities, Medellin offers excellent dental care options.
- Cartagena: Combine your dental care with a beach holiday in this stunning coastal city, which also offers reputable dental clinics.
